National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S)
If you have NDIS funding, you may be able to use it for our mental health services.
Plan-managed, self-managed, and NDIA-managed participants can use their funding.
Our team can help you check whether your plan includes psychology, counselling, or other supports.

Employee Assistance Program (EAP)
Some workplaces offer confidential counselling for their employees through an Employee Assistance Program (EAP).
If your employer has EAP, you may be able to see us at no cost to you.
Ask your workplace HR team if you are covered, or contact us for help.
- KHC currently accepts referrals from AccessEAP, Converge International, and PeopleSense

Aged Care Packages
Older people receiving support through aged care packages may also be able to use this funding for mental health services.
Speak with your aged care provider to see if counselling or psychological support can be included.
